Virtual whiteboards prove vital for remote developer teams

As the globe adapted to function from home orders and commenced functioning in additional dispersed, distant groups more than the previous two years, a single popular refrain from program developers was the absence of a genuinely distant different to a whiteboard.

No matter if it is the dreaded whiteboard test throughout a job job interview, or Mark Zuckerberg and Eduardo Saverin’s apocryphal scribbling of the initial Facebook algorithm on a dorm place window, the whiteboard has prolonged been a critical resource to enable programmers fully grasp and make clear the complicated programs they are developing and working.

Now, as developer groups proceed to come to be additional dispersed, distant, and asynchronous, the virtual whiteboard is getting to be a critical resource for collaborating on specialized problems, educating sessions, and job interviews.

Obtaining that 1,000-ft perspective

“For engineers, the whiteboard is a powerful resource to enable visualize unique pieces of an software,” Jevin Maltais, engineering supervisor at thoroughly-dispersed automation program business Zapier, instructed InfoWorld. “Developing specialized solutions signifies there is a ton of interaction and communication between various pieces of a system, and the whiteboard is a good way to visualize that.”

Kansas City-dependent program growth agency Crema has been using the well-known whiteboarding resource Miro for at least four years now (Miro is now a client of theirs), perfectly prior to the pandemic pressured workers and customers to function together remotely. But usage ticked up considerably throughout the pandemic.

“We have a great place of work with whiteboards everywhere you go for undertaking scheduling, specialized scheduling, and troubleshooting,” Neal Dyrkacz, a senior software developer at Crema, instructed InfoWorld. Now, considerably of that function is performed and saved in just Miro. “Understanding a superior-stage architecture, what we will need, the 3rd-occasion APIs we will hit—getting that 1,000 ft perspective is important for absolutely everyone,” he additional.

Lex Sanders, an software developer at Crema, discovered the Miro whiteboards massively important throughout her early times at the business as an apprentice. “I used a ton of time whiteboarding and carrying out collaborative function with mentors,” she reported.

The change from actual physical to virtual whiteboards is not seamless, however. One popular issue is the uncomplicated logistics of changing from a actual physical natural environment, the place it is normally obvious who is driving the session with a marker in their hand, to a virtual natural environment in which any person can attract at any time. Maltais at Zapier admits this is nevertheless a obstacle for engineering groups. “Coming up with cultural norms of who can attract when is nevertheless strange,” he admits.

Powering the asynchronous function revolution

AWS senior developer advocate Justin Garrison has worked in thoroughly distant groups for a number of years now, but as a visible learner he generally craved a uncomplicated way to make clear issues to colleagues visually.

As those people groups have come to be additional globally dispersed, Garrison is seeking for superior techniques to express this information and facts asynchronously, so that his colleagues in Tokyo or Rome can capture up when they wake up.

“You just can’t agenda a conference for absolutely everyone and carrying out a thing interactive is also hard,” Garrison reported, noting that existing resources don’t have out-of-the-box guidance for asynchronous recording and playback yet, a thing which is superior on his 2022 desire listing.

Maltais at Zapier has also been grappling with this difficulty more than the previous calendar year or so. “Some of the powerful, non-obvious techniques we use virtual whiteboards listed here is functioning in an asynchronous way to leverage the whiteboard as the visible resource, but allow for individuals to lead in their have time asynchronously” he reported. “Digital whiteboards can be quite prolonged working. We can report the conference, enabling that particular person to lead to that whiteboard whilst they watch that evolve.”

Zapier has embraced asynchronous whiteboarding as it seems to be for superior techniques to interact engineers who only get to satisfy in particular person at the time or 2 times a calendar year, pandemic enabling. “I believe it is truly significant for engineers to be listened to,” Maltais reported. “They generally function solo and don’t have the working experience of becoming ready to communicate and question concerns, so acquiring techniques to superior collaborate and share ideas is truly powerful.”

Which virtual whiteboard is best for developers?

Garrison has performed additional trialing of virtual whiteboards than most developers, and his own beloved is the quite uncomplicated Whiteboard On the internet (WBO), paired with a tablet and stylus for drawing.

“I like the ephemerality of it, it’s not documentation,” he reported. “At a whiteboard you are possessing a discussion, ninety% of the value is what you are expressing and 10% is what is on the whiteboard.”

He has also had some achievements with Zoom’s integrated whiteboard attribute throughout conferences, but doesn’t like how siloed the resource is. Miro was a critical resource throughout his time at the Walt Disney Business, regardless of possessing some negatives. “It’s not meant for a pen, which signifies it’s not a whiteboard application for me,” he reported.

Zapier is also trialing Facebook’s Horizon Workrooms VR resource for additional immersive virtual whiteboarding sessions between developers. “The whiteboarding working experience is truly impressive in that location,” Maltais reported.

Hrafn Eiriksson, CTO at United kingdom-dependent betting exchange Smarkets, employs 3 unique whiteboards for unique purposes. He likes a uncomplicated virtual whiteboard called Excalidraw for spur of the second sessions, Miro for additional official conferences since of its full attribute set, and HackerRank’s whiteboards for conducting specialized interviews.

Even though the virtual whiteboard appears to be an unavoidable component of the program developer working experience, as we change into whatever the future iteration of function will look like article-pandemic, there nevertheless is no obvious consensus substitute for the simplicity of a dry erase marker on a actual physical whiteboard.

“We’ve likely attempted about a dozen unique services for whiteboarding more than the very last few of years,” Eiriksson reported. “What I would say is that no issue which resource we use, distant whiteboarding truly does not defeat an in-particular person session.”

Copyright © 2021 IDG Communications, Inc.

Maria J. Danford

Next Post

GitLab 14.6 shines on distributed deployments

Thu Dec 30 , 2021
GitLab fourteen.6, an update of the GitLab application shipping and delivery platform, focuses on enhancements for geographically dispersed software deployments. Assistance for Microsoft’s .Web 6 application enhancement platform is highlighted, as nicely. Unveiled December 22, GitLab fourteen.6 simplifies configuration of GitLab Geo, which now will allow for both read through-only […]

You May Like